MANTECH seeks a motivated, career and customer-oriented Senior Combat Systems Engineer to join our team working in Dahlgren, VA.  This is a hybrid, part-time position requiring 2 days a week onsite, 20 hours per week.

In this role, you will support strategic planning for land-based test site capabilities. This position is crucial for planning, activating, and sustaining site capabilities to meet critical certification milestones.
 

Responsibilities include but are not limited to:

  • Support the Government AEGIS Land Based Test Sites Manager in developing and implementing long range strategic goals to streamline the combat systems test and certification process

  • Support the implementation of a distributive test environment and seamless data transfer between testing sites

  • Conduct regular meetings with stakeholders and customers to gather, validate, and coordinate tasks

  • Prepare and coordinate inputs for status reports, briefings, and information inquiries

  • Provide quality technical leadership and produce deliverables and other products with a high degree of accuracy

Minimum Qualifications:

  • 10+ years of engineering experience with Navy combat systems

  • Master’s degree in a technical discipline or a Bachelor’s degree in a technical discipline and 15+ years of relevant experience may be considered in lieu of Master's degree

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ience working with development and testing of Navy surface ship combat systems at land-based test sites

  • Experience leading programmatic meetings with internal and external stakeholders and program monthly reviews

Clearance Requirements:

  • Must be a U.S. Citizen and possess an active or current Secret Security Clearance
